Web7 jan. 2024 · To make this groundbreaking discovery, the team examined DNA taken from skin biopsies of 190 giraffes collected across Africa. This sampling included populations from all nine previously recognised giraffe subspecies, which may now be spread across four separate species. Web18 aug. 2016 · At the time, Garamba was home to just 40 Kordofan giraffes ― the only remaining population in the Congo. Shortly after Hamlin’s sighting, a park ranger reportedly heard a series of gunshots. The following morning, rangers found three dead, bullet-riddled giraffes, missing nothing but the ends of their tails.
WebSince 1999, the giraffe population in Africa has decreased by about 40%. According to the Giraffe Conservation Foundation, numbers have fallen from 140,000 to 80,000. While the slump went largely unnoticed by the world for some time, conservationists in the field took notice.
